These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Hagar Shores area can be challenging. Home prices in Hagar Shores are now at a median cost of $161,800, lower than the Michigan average of $196,062.
The average cost of rent is $788/mo in Hagar Shores,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Hagar Shores area. While nearly 52.09% of residents own their homes outright in Hagar Shores, 13.57%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Hagar Shores is $3,912 per month. Households that rent pay about 20.14% of their income on rent here.
